Gbase-数据-database-多活架构

Gbase-数据-database-多活架构

技术问答类推广文案:GBase 数据库多活架构详解


一、什么是 GBase 数据库?

GBase 是一款由南大通用自主研发的高性能关系型数据库系统,广泛应用于金融、政务、电信等对数据安全和性能要求极高的行业。GBase 提供了多种版本,如 GBase 8a、GBase 8s 等,适用于不同的业务场景。

在现代企业中,随着业务规模的不断扩展,传统的单节点数据库已难以满足高可用、高并发、低延迟的需求。因此,越来越多的企业开始关注 多活架构(Multi-Active Architecture) 的应用与部署。


二、什么是多活架构?

多活架构是指在一个系统中同时运行多个独立但功能一致的实例,这些实例可以分布在不同的地理位置或物理环境中。通过数据同步、负载均衡、故障切换等机制,确保系统在任意一个节点发生故障时,仍能正常提供服务,实现“零停机”或“最小化停机”。

与传统的主从复制架构不同,多活架构强调的是 所有节点均可读写,具备更高的灵活性和容灾能力。


三、GBase 数据库支持多活架构吗?

是的,GBase 数据库支持多活架构设计,尤其在 GBase 8a 和 GBase 8s 中,提供了丰富的高可用和分布式能力,能够构建出稳定的多活集群环境。

GBase 多活架构通常基于以下核心技术:


四、为什么选择 GBase 多活架构?

  1. 高可用性
    多活架构有效避免了单点故障风险,即使某地数据中心宕机,业务依然可以继续运行。

  2. 灵活扩展性
    可根据业务增长情况,动态增加节点,无需停机升级。

  3. 异地容灾能力
    支持跨地域部署,满足国家对数据本地化和安全性方面的要求。

  4. 降低运维复杂度
    GBase 提供完善的管理工具和监控系统,帮助用户轻松维护多活集群。


五、GBase 多活架构的应用场景有哪些?


六、如何部署 GBase 多活架构?

部署 GBase 多活架构一般包括以下几个步骤:

  1. 规划拓扑结构
    根据业务需求,确定节点数量、分布位置及网络连接方式。

  2. 配置数据同步机制
    使用 GBase 提供的同步工具或中间件,建立多节点之间的数据同步通道。

  3. 设置负载均衡策略
    配置客户端或中间件,将请求合理分配到各个活跃节点。

  4. 实施故障切换机制
    配置自动检测与切换策略,确保系统稳定性。

  5. 进行压力测试与调优
    通过模拟高并发、故障场景,验证多活架构的可靠性与性能表现。


七、GBase 多活架构的未来发展方向

随着云计算、边缘计算和AI技术的发展,GBase 正在持续优化其多活架构,进一步提升系统的智能化水平和自动化程度。未来,GBase 将更加强调:


八、总结

GBase 数据库凭借其强大的多活架构能力,为企业提供了稳定、高效、安全的数据管理解决方案。无论是面对突发的业务高峰,还是复杂的容灾需求,GBase 都能帮助企业构建出真正意义上的“全天候”数据库系统。

如果您正在寻找一款支持多活架构的数据库产品,GBase 是一个值得信赖的选择。


如需了解更多关于 GBase 多活架构的技术细节或案例分析,欢迎联系我们的技术团队,获取专属解决方案!

相关图片